Psalm 119h - Heth - You Are My Portion O LORD!

Section 8 of 22 set to music. All eight verses of this section of Psalm 119 begin with Heth (KJV: CHETH) the 8th letter of the Hebrew alphabet. - (High Resolution version available at zcpress.org/psalm 119)



YOU are my portion. What a statement! It flies in the face of today's "Bless Me" generation, who seek the Giver for His gifts and scarcely look Him in the eye for all that He lavishes upon us. --I have considered my ways and I have TURNED my steps TOWARD Your statutes.-- This implies that before this the Psalmist was not adequately focused on the Lord. But NOW things are different. NOW that he has caught a glimpse of the Giver who is so slow to take offense and so quick to forgive... NOW he hastens to obey and to face the consequences and the hatred of those who have not yet received such a vision. --Though the wicked bind me with ropes...-- He has be joined to a company of those who have met the living God --I am a friend to those who fear You...-- And like the cherubim that Isaiah saw crying "Holy, Holy, Holy is the Lord. The earth is FILLED with His glory" so this Psalmist sees that God has left no nook and cranny of the earth bereft of His mercy and lovingkindness. And he entreats the Lord to instruct him in THAT way.
